NSU Athletics Announces Tailgating Guidelines for 2013 Football Season

NORFOLK, Va. – Norfolk State University Athletics announced today its tailgating and parking guidelines for the 2013 football season. 

A committee of NSU administrators including representatives from the athletics department, facilities management, alumni relations, campus police, parking and the NSU Athletics Foundation collaborated to develop the plan. Due to construction of the new Nursing and Allied Health Building being built next to the Lyman Beecher Brooks Library on Presidential Parkway, parking is limited from the campus's main entrance on Park Avenue.  

“Norfolk State University is experiencing significant growth in all areas.  The construction of new buildings that are designed to meet the academic needs of our students is vital to the mission of the University,” said NSU Athletics Director Marty Miller.  “We realize that on-campus parking will be limited during the upcoming football season. However, I believe we have been successful in identifying solutions that are in the best interest of our fans and the University."

The primary tailgate area will be the open space next to the band practice field behind the Hamm Fine Arts Building.  The cost for a 22 feet x 22 feet space for season ticket holders for the entire season (seven games) is $350.  Cost is $60 for a single game.

Non-season ticket holders will be charged $530 to tailgate at all seven home games and $90 per individual game.  Recreation vehicles (RVs) will be charged $100 per game.  Vending of food or other merchandise in tailgate areas is prohibited. 

NSU Athletics Foundation members will park in Lot 4 located across from the Hamm Fine Arts Building and Lot 5 near the NSU Softball Field.

Tailgating reservations are now being accepted from season ticket holders, while requests from the general public (non season ticket holders) will be accepted beginning July 1. Fans can download the application form at www.nsuspartans.com or pick them up in the main NSU athletics office, Room 161 of Joseph Echols Hall. 

The 2013 NSU football season begins on Aug. 31 when the Spartans host Maine at Dick Price Stadium in the Virginia Lottery Labor Day Classic.
